Mountaintop Weddings

Tucked away high in the beautiful central mountains of Idaho, Brundage Mountain offers picturesque mountaintop weddings. This majestic location serves as a beautiful, natural backdrop for your wedding. Brundage Mountain Catering’s on-site culinary team will create a delicious and unique menu, featuring a wide variety of cuisine choices. With a summit ceremony and a reception at the base of the mountain, the wedding of your dreams awaits.

Mountain Ceremony

Mountaintop weddings at Brundage Mountain offer 360° panoramic views of the Payette National Forest and a backdrop of both Payette and Little Payette Lakes. Guests are lifted up over 1,900 ft of elevation via Bluebird Chairlift with the ceremony deck located just 50 yards away.

Read about Joe & Sarah’s 2025 wedding HERE.

Base Area Reception

The brand new Bluebird Pavilion tent located adjacent to the new Mountain Adventure Center and Bluebird Chairlift offers 3200 square feet of covered space, tables & chairs, dance floor, catering and bar, and space for a DJ or band. Your unforgettable reception is located at the base area of Brundage Mountain with easy access to parking, the Bridal Party quarters and restrooms.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many guests can I have at the summit? At the reception?

All wedding guests are welcome at the summit. Each guest will receive a lift ticket for the day. We can accommodate up to 50 chairs at the
ceremony site with standing room available.

Is there a time restriction for the ceremony at the summit? At the reception?

Yes, the latest time for the ceremony on the summit is 3:00 PM. All guests must down load the lift by 5:00 PM.

Can I decorate at the ceremony site?

Yes, you are welcome to bring your own decor and you can start set-up at 9:00 AM the day of the event at the Base Area Venue. Set up at the Ceremony Site is available at 10am. Please remember all clean-up and removal of decorations must be done at the end of the event.

Is there handicap access to the summit?

All access to the summit is via the Bluebird Chairlift. All guests must be able to load and unload the chairlift. ADA access can be requested in advance.

Can my dog(s) join us for the event?

Yes, at the reception! Dogs are not welcomed on the lift and cannot join the ceremony.

Are any of these venues closed to the public when booked?

Booking during the open season, these venues are not entirely closed to the public and daily operations. However, the public are courteous to your event and we do our best to keep your event private. The base area venue space is not open to the public and would be your own private space.

Is there space available for the bridal party to get ready?

Yes, both the groom and the bride have access to separate areas to get ready.

Can I bring in my own caterer?

All catering needs are provided from our in-house catering team. You are welcome to use your own baker for your cake.

Do you provide linens?

No, you will need to provide your own linens for your tables and napkins.

What time can I get to the summit to decorate?

The chairlift opens at 10:00 AM, you can load the lift and begin decorating immediately.

How late can my reception go?

The venue is available for the receptions until 10:00 PM. Decorations need to be cleaned by 11:00 PM.

How many guests can I invite?

Outdoor capacity and indoor space is limited to 200 guests.
